Landscape Leader - H250 - Middlesex

Our client is an established company who build gardens for designers and discerning homeowners.  They regularly build show gardens at RHS shows. This position is a key role in the company to fulfil these exciting projects and to be part of their growth plan. They are based in Middlesex.

Job Description:

The main duty will be to complete garden works according to the allocated budgets, to required finishes and to achieve customer satisfaction. To manage assistants/contractors, to make best use of time and materials and other resources. Protect and promote the assets of the Company. The work is to make decisions about how and when work is carried out, who will do it and how. This is a working foreman role. You need to know what to do, be able to direct and motivate others while doing your own work and confident to manage the ordering of materials. Tools and vehicle will be provided. You need to be able to make good judgements about the factors that influence the success of the work. (weather, skills, time, customer expectations, professional standards).

Key Skills:

The successful candidate will be able to –

  • Mark out, dig and prepare bases for paving and driveways in compacted type one or concrete. Lay paving, blocks and stone using mortar. Build walls, free standing and retaining. Brick and block/render.
  • Set out and erect fencing, fix trellis, build pergolas, build sheds, fix edging, lay decking.
  • To identify and use tools appropriate to the task, direct other operatives in their duties. Undertake to use PPE at all times when carrying out any hazardous activities. Prepare a risk assessment of any activities which are deemed to be hazardous and present to the Proprietor.
  • Ensure all operatives keep the site clean and tidy, control the use of materials and their storage to ensure the efficiency of the work operations and the safety of anyone in the work area.
  • Be the person responsible for health and safety, first aid and recording accidents.
  • Fill out a time record for each contract. Record any and all materials that were used in any contract as recorded in the contract document. Compile other operatives’ timesheets into the contract record.
  • Fill out a personal timesheet daily with details of operations undertaken, location, materials used and total time.
  • To oversee ordering and delivery of materials, check for damage, unload with due care, check all items correspond with paperwork, identify a suitable safe and secure storage area. Inform the proprietor of any anomaly. Check stocks of materials are sufficient for any given contract and ensure work does not stop from lack of materials.
  • Advise the proprietor if there is a need to vary the contract. If the customer requests to change the scope of the work, to add more work or if he believes there is a need to vary the agreed work.
  • Other actions that will be required: Setting out, operating tools, counting, measuring, digging, cutting, nailing, fixing, laying, building, rendering, erecting, planting, levelling, drainage and any other task that may be required in the renovation, or creation of landscape elements. All finishes shall be to recognised standards and specifications.
Additional Information:
Measurables (KPI)
  • Achieve customer satisfaction.
  • Complete work within time targets and with few defects.
  • All contracted work paid.
  • All extra work invoiced and paid.
  • Staff retention and training.

Measurement of the work will be according to customer surveys, photos, on site review and timesheet targets.  A bonus scheme applies to this role and is paid quarterly according to these criteria.
